New York-based alternatives firm D.E. Shaw has added a 20-year Lloyds TSB Bank veteran to head its European debt and equity capital business.
Michael Joseph was named head of D.E. Shaw Direct Capital, a division of D. E. Shaw & Co. (U.K.), Ltd. that will focus on providing debt and equity capital to businesses in the United Kingdom and continental Europe.
Joseph most recently served as managing director of structured finance at Lloyds TSB, where he has also worked in the private equity group. Before joining Lloyds TSB, he was investment director at British p.e. and venture capital firm 3i Group.
